Medal of Honor Frontline combines all the major themes from the originals and adds in some other great ones. Giacchino uses more instruments to his advantage and an entire adult choir to play out the dramatic Sturmgeist theme. Highlights are 'Manorhouse Rally', 'Arnhem', and 'Escaping Gotha', a seven minute roller-coaster ride that ends up inside a stolen German jet. while it is less beautiful than Underground, it is wonderful in describing the action and sadness all around. When Giacchino's score for the original MOH was released, film score buffs and critics alike praised its musicality and its proper placement in the videogame. It set a standard for orchestral music in future videogames and showed the film score community that Michael Giacchino knows how to write exhilerating music for orchestra. MOH Frontline outshines MOH and MOH Underground with its tremendous impact and orchestral/choral power; tracks like The Shipyards of Lorient, Manor House Rally, The Halftrack Chase, and Sturmgeist's Armored Train generate excitement while the superior softer tracks like Operation Market Garden and Arnhem stimulate emotion with fantastic string and choral performances. Giacchino hit the nail square on the head with this score. Its power cannot be matched.
